Steps to becoming a personal trainer

1. Education and Certification: Begin by obtaining certification from accredited organisations like The Health and Fitness Institute. These certifications validate your knowledge and competence in designing effective fitness programs. Practical training is often a part of these programs, giving you hands-on experience.

2. Developing Skills: Beyond technical knowledge, effective communication, empathy, and motivational skills are essential. You’ll work closely with clients to understand their goals, tailor workouts, and provide encouragement throughout their fitness journeys.

3. Gaining Experience: Seek opportunities to gain practical experience. This can range from internships at gyms to shadowing experienced trainers. Hands-on learning will not only enhance your skills but also build confidence in handling diverse clientele.

4. Building a Client Base: As you gain experience, focus on building a client base. Networking within the fitness community, leveraging social media, and offering trial sessions can help attract clients and build your reputation.
